    My husband is with f1 visa. But there is a bulgarian school which need a bulgarian history teacher, and because he has a master degree in history, they wand him to teach there. My question is can they apply for him, because now with this F1 status he doesn't have right to work? I heard something that they also can apply for green card for him, if he works there. If somebody knows something about this and how to do it please help as.

    The school must meet eligibility of visa sponsor... your husband cannot work under F-1, he might be eligible under J-1 but not green card. The hiring process is long and complicated, better consult immigration attorney.
